Job Description

  • Certified Medication Assistant
  • Join the Heartsworth Center Nursing team as a Certified Medication Assistant in Vinita, Oklahoma!
  • At Heartsworth Center Nursing, we are committed to providing exceptional care and services to our residents. As a Certified Medication Assistant, you will play a vital role in our healthcare team, assisting with medication management, care coordination, and resident support.
  • Responsibilities:
  • Assist with medication administration
  • : Safely dispense medications to residents, ensuring accuracy and compliance with regulatory requirements.
  • Provide care coordination
  • : Collaborate with registered nurses, physicians, and other healthcare professionals to develop and implement individualized care plans.
  • Assist with daily living activities
  • : Support residents with daily tasks, such as grooming, bathing, and dressing.
  • Monitor resident status
  • : Observe and report changes in resident condition, vital signs, and behavior to healthcare staff.
  • Maintain accurate records
  • : Document medications administered, care provided, and resident progress in accordance with facility policies.
  • Requirements:
  • Certification as a Medication Assistant
  • : Valid certification as a Medication Assistant in the state of Oklahoma.
  • High school diploma or equivalent
  • : A high school diploma or equivalent is required.
  • FLEXIBLE SCHEDULE
  • : Ability to work a variety of shifts, including days, evenings, and weekends.
